Memory leak? Firefox won't load pages/open.
Ok, I believe there is a memory leak. I am surfing ok then a page wont load. I go to taskmgr and I show that one firefox has 104,990 K of memory. The rest have at most 3,000K. After the page won't load I close Firefox. It won't open. I have to turn on PC and unplug to get it to open again.
This issue can be caused by an extension or plugin that isn't working properly.
Start Firefox in [[Safe Mode]] to check if one of the add-ons is causing the problem (switch to the DEFAULT theme: Tools > Add-ons > Themes).
* Don't make any changes on the Safe mode start window.
See:
* [[Troubleshooting extensions and themes]]
* [[Troubleshooting plugins]] -

many thanks. In recent times, the error-message-free launch failures of both iTunes and QuickTime have often been indicating that some application (other than QuickTime itself) has dropped old QuickTime componentry in your system files.
So just in case we'll go looking for older QuickTime componentry in the most common locations for it to be stashed.
First we'll need to change some view settings.
In your Start menu, open Computer.
In your Organise menu, select Folder Options.
In the View tab, make sure that "Show hidden files and folders" is selected, and Hide extensions for known file types is unchecked.
Click OK.
Now in Computer, open your C:\ drive (or whichever drive you have your operating system installed on).
Open the "Windows" folder.
Open the "System32" folder.
What files and folders can you see in there with QuickTime in the title? (In a standard installation of Quicktime you should be seeing precisely two files... QuickTime.qts and QuickTimeVR.qtx ... and no QuickTime folders whatsoever.) -

How do I uninstall an extention that won't load.
When I start Safari it complains about an old extension and says it won't load it. I already have a newer version installed. I can see the new version of the extension under preferences, but not the old version. How do I get rid of the old version, so I don't continue to get this warning?
Uninstalling the new version does nothing for this problem.Try moving the extension to the trash from ~/Library/Safari
If that doesn't help, go to ~/Library/Safari
Move the Extensions.plist file from the Safari folder to the Trash.
Quit and relaunch Safari to test.
If you aren't sure how to find those files..
Open the Finder. From the Finder menu bar click Go > Go to Folder
Click Go then type or copy/paste: ~/Library/Safari
Click Go. -
